  • 3. To what extent were you given support and guidance by management/your supervisor(s)?
  • Training has been excellent at Enterprise Rent a Car. The training folder covers all aspects of business from learning how to run a branch on a day to day basis to setting up new accounts and going out marketing and networking. Support has always been there for me when I needed it.

  • 5. How much responsibility were you given during your placement?
  • Right from the first day, you are given a hue amount of responsibility in the branch to help with the day to day running on the branch. As you progress through your training folder, it feels as though you are handed more responsibility as your knowledge about the company increases.
